In the "maven-plugin-parent" pom, you can add the following snippet, then
you can actually REMOVE the META-INF/LICENSE and
META-INF/INCUBATOR_NOTICE.txt files from your source tree. (You can
optionally remove the NOTICE files as well as this will create new ones based
on the dependencies. However, if the NOTICE file is left, it will use it
instead of creating a new one.)
<plugin>
<artifactId>maven-remote-resources-plugin</artifactId>
<version>1.0-alpha-2</version>
<executions>
<execution>
<goals>
<goal>process</goal>
</goals>
<configuration>
<resourceBundles>
<resourceBundle>org.apache:apache-jar-resource-bundle:1.1</resourceBundle>
<resourceBundle>org.apache:apache-incubator-disclaimer-resource-bundle:1.0</resourceBundle>
</resourceBundles>
<properties>
<addLicense>true</addLicense>
<preProjectText>Put the Oracle thing here in
a cdata section type of thing.
</preProjectText>
</properties>
</configuration>
</execution>
</executions>
</plugin>
